Job Title: Construction Surveillance Technicians

Tetra Tech is seeking experienced Construction Surveillance Technicians (CSTs) to support a U.S. Embassy construction project in Brasilia, Brazil. As a CST, you will play a critical role in ensuring the security and integrity of the construction site.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Monitor un-cleared workers during designated phases of construction
  • X-ray and inspect materials, equipment, and furnishings designated for use within the Controlled Access Area (CAA) of the construction site
  • Assist in the random selection of materials required for construction and installation in the CAA and areas contiguous to the CAA
  • Maintain detailed daily logs during your tour of duty, to be submitted to the Contractor's Team Leader and the Site Security Manager
Requirements:
  • U.S. Citizen
  • At least 21 years of age
  • Top-Secret U.S. Government Security Clearance
  • In good physical health and meet medical requirements for the position
  • At least 5 years' experience in construction security surveillance, technical surveillance countermeasures, industrial or government security involving counterintelligence, construction quality assurance, or hands-on supervisory construction experience
  • Ability to learn principles of all construction disciplines, including Civil, Architectural, and Mechanical, Electrical, and Electronic Engineering
  • Ability to read and analyze designs/blueprints and recognize architect's intended use
  • Ability to analyze designs and structural complexities, which are intended to mask an ulterior purpose not wanted by the architect
  • Knowledge of Technical Surveillance Countermeasures, construction principles, and devices used by hostile and friendly intelligence services for the purpose of clandestine surveillance
  • Ability to become thoroughly knowledgeable of Department of State security procedures and the level of security required in various parts of each facility under construction/renovation
  • Ability to effectively communicate in English and write detailed reports, analyses of problems, findings, and security situations which require staff actions
  • Capable of independent decision-making, possess a high degree of individual initiative, and function with minimal supervision
